About Advocacy Team In-home Care

Advocacy Team In-Home Care A Comprehensive In-Home Care that provides Medical and Personal Care to individuals who are chronically ill, disabled or suffering from cognitive impairments. Advocacy Team serves as a resource for the client’s family, and the community. Our Team typically work for clients who want to remain at home but need assistance with Activities of Daily Living such as bathing, toileting, dressing, eating, and housework/house management. Home care nurses administer medication, monitor vital signs and educate patients on health care. RN services also included if needed. We have registered nurses, caregivers and companions to work for in-home patients. Home care nurses observe and assess the health of their clients. We monitor vital signs and reactions to medications and look for changes in behavior and condition. Our home care nurses report directly to the client’s physician and family, especially regarding concerns for new medical conditions or changes in medical status. Get Costs

Tips for Evaluating Your Options

Safety is a primary concern when seniors and their families look for Seniorsite Living. To ensure that a community meets your needs and expectations, we recommend that seniors and family members:

  • Tour the location

    Touring allows you to speak to current residents and staff, and helps you confirm the accuracy of the community description and photos. Use our touring checklist to help guide your visit.

  • Confirm the availability of required services

    Before you commit, make sure that the community offers all the services your senior needs, and that those services can be provided within your budget.

  • Know the California regulations for living type

    Each state has its own laws and inspections processes to ensure seniors reside in a safe environment. Depending on your state, you may even be able to look up inspection reports for the community(ies) you're considering.
